>cd02642 R3H_encore_like R3H domain of encore-like and DIP1-like proteins. Drosophila encore is involved in the germline exit after four mitotic divisions, by facilitating SCF-ubiquitin-proteasome-dependent proteolysis. Maize DBF1-interactor protein 1 (DIP1) containing an R3H domain is a potential regulator of DBF1 activity in stress responses. The name of the R3H domain comes from the characteristic spacing of the most conserved arginine and histidine residues. The function of the domain is predicted to bind ssDNA or ssRNA in a sequence-specific manner.

>PF01424 R3H:  R3H domain;  InterPro: IPR001374 The R3H motif: a domain that binds single-stranded nucleic acids. The most prominent feature of the R3H motif is the presence of an invariant arginine residue and a highly conserved histidine residue that are separated by three residues. The motif also displays a conserved pattern of hydrophobic residues, prolines and glycines. The R3H motif is present in proteins from a diverse range of organisms that includes Eubacteria, green plants, fungi and various groups of metazoans. Intriguingly, it has not yet been identified in Archaea and Escherichia coli. The sequences that contain the R3H domain, many of which are hypothetical proteins predicted from genome sequencing projects, can be grouped into eight families on the basis of similarities outside the R3H region. Three of the families contain ATPase domains either upstream (families II and VII) or downstream of the R3H domain (family VIII). The N-terminal part of members of family VII contains an SF1 helicase domain5. The C-terminal part of family VIII contains an SF2 DEAH helicase domain5. The ATPase domain in the members of family II is similar to the stage-III sporulation protein AA (S3AA_BACSU), the proteasome ATPase, bacterial transcription-termination factor r and the mitochondrial F1-ATPase b subunit (the F5 helicase family5). Family VI contains Cys-rich repeats6, as well as a ring-type zinc finger upstream of the R3H domain. JAG bacterial proteins (family I) contain a KH domain N-terminal to the R3H domain. The functions of other domains in R3H proteins support the notion that the R3H domain might be involved in interactions with single-stranded nucleic acids [].; GO: 0003676 nucleic acid binding; PDB: 1WHR_A 1MSZ_A 1UG8_A 3GKU_B 2CPM_A.

>PF08110 Antimicrobial15:  Ocellatin family;  InterPro: IPR012518 This family consists of the ocellatin family of antimicrobial peptides. Ocellatins are produced from the electrical-stimulated skin secretions of the South American frog, Leptodactylus ocellatus (Argus frog). The family consists of three structurally related peptides, ocellatin 1, ocellatin 2 and ocellatin 3. These peptides present haemolytic activity against human erythrocytes and are also active against Escherichia coli [].; GO: 0019836 hemolysis by symbiont of host erythrocytes, 0005576 extracellular region

>PF05572 Peptidase_M43:  Pregnancy-associated plasma protein-A;  InterPro: IPR008754 In the MEROPS database peptidases and peptidase homologues are grouped into clans and families. Clans are groups of families for which there is evidence of common ancestry based on a common structural fold:  Each clan is identified with two letters, the first representing the catalytic type of the families included in the clan (with the letter 'P' being used for a clan containing families of more than one of the catalytic types serine, threonine and cysteine). Some families cannot yet be assigned to clans, and when a formal assignment is required, such a family is described as belonging to clan A-, C-, M-, N-, S-, T- or U-, according to the catalytic type. Some clans are divided into subclans because there is evidence of a very ancient divergence within the clan, for example MA(E), the gluzincins, and MA(M), the metzincins. Peptidase families are grouped by their catalytic type, the first character representing the catalytic type: A, aspartic; C, cysteine; G, glutamic acid; M, metallo; N, asparagine; S, serine; T, threonine; and U, unknown. The serine, threonine and cysteine peptidases utilise the amino acid as a nucleophile and form an acyl intermediate - these peptidases can also readily act as transferases. In the case of aspartic, glutamic and metallopeptidases, the nucleophile is an activated water molecule. In the case of the asparagine endopeptidases, the nucleophile is asparagine and all are self-processing endopeptidases.   In many instances the structural protein fold that characterises the clan or family may have lost its catalytic activity, yet retain its function in protein recognition and binding.  Metalloproteases are the most diverse of the four main types of protease, with more than 50 families identified to date. In these enzymes, a divalent cation, usually zinc, activates the water molecule. The metal ion is held in place by amino acid ligands, usually three in number. The known metal ligands are His, Glu, Asp or Lys and at least one other residue is required for catalysis, which may play an electrophillic role. Of the known metalloproteases, around half contain an HEXXH motif, which has been shown in crystallographic studies to form part of the metal-binding site []. The HEXXH motif is relatively common, but can be more stringently defined for metalloproteases as 'abXHEbbHbc', where 'a' is most often valine or threonine and forms part of the S1' subsite in thermolysin and neprilysin, 'b' is an uncharged residue, and 'c' a hydrophobic residue. Proline is never found in this site, possibly because it would break the helical structure adopted by this motif in metalloproteases []. This group of metallopeptidases belong to the MEROPS peptidase M43 (cytophagalysin family, clan MA(M)), subfamily M43. The predicted active site residues for members of this family and thermolysin, the type example for clan MA, occur in the motif HEXXH. The type example of this family is the pregnancy-associated plasma protein A (PAPP-A), which cleaves insulin-like growth factor (IGF) binding protein-4 (IGFBP-4), causing a dramatic reduction in its affinity for IGF-I and -II. Through this mechanism, PAPP-A is a regulator of IGF bioactivity in several systems, including the Homo sapiens ovary and the cardiovascular system [, , , ].; PDB: 3LUN_A 3LUM_B 2J83_A 2CKI_A.
